March is National Essential Tremor Awareness Month. We would like to take some time to increase the understanding of one of the most common movement (8 times more likely than Parkinson’s Disease). Essential tremor (ET) is a neurological condition that causes involuntary shaking often in the hands, but also in the arms, head, larynx, tongue, and chin. While sometimes disregarded as “shaky hands” this condition can meaningfully impact day to day living and independence. Feeling anxious or overwhelmed? Try this simple 5-4-3-2-1 grounding technique to bring yourself back to the present moment.

👉 5 things you can SEE
👉 4 things you can FEEL
👉 3 things you can HEAR
👉 2 things you can SMELL
👉 1 thing you can TASTE

Sometimes your senses are the best tool for calming your mind 💭✨

Some food for thought! Did you know that what you eat can significantly impact your brain health throughout your life? A recent article highlights the strong connection between diet and cognitive function. Nutrient-rich foods can boost memory and protect against neurodegenerative diseases, while processed foods may have the opposite effect.

The takeaway? Prioritize a balanced diet full of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and healthy fats for a sharper mind as you age. Let's nourish our brains for a healthier future! 💪❤️
